In this powerful keynote, Tony Sanneh will explore how enrolling others in a shared vision turns individual effort into a movement. Drawing on his journey from the 2002 FIFA World Cup and two MLS Cup championships to founding The Sanneh Foundation, one of Minnesota's most impactful youth-serving organizations, Tony will share how real change is never carried by one leader alone. His work spans the Twin Cities and Haiti, where the Foundation's Haitian Initiative has enrolled families, coaches, community partners, and even government ministries in a shared vision: using soccer to keep kids in Cité Soleil in school, fed, and growing as leaders.
For Haiti Outreach, enrollment is at the heart of our model. Communities lead their own development because they own the vision, and that ownership is what makes change last.
